Five authentic tales of people young and old, searching for a fresh adventure and new beginnings, all with one thing in common - they all take place on the exquisite island of Okinawa.
2002
1995
1996
2000
2005
2001
1991
2006
2016
2024
2020
2004
1985
—
1939